| Member Duties : Philadelphia Zoo’s PHENND Fellow has a portfolio of work that falls into 3 areas:
1. Continuing the administration and growth of the Zoo’s Community Access programs
2. Coordinating and implementing on and off site cultural and community events
3. Increasing accessibility for members of the autistic community and senior citizens.
Conduct baseline assessments of inclusion for the communities mentioned. Build partnerships with local organizations, senior centers and advocates to best support this initiative. Determine trainings that will orient and teach staff about the specific needs of the communities they are working with and increase staff awareness on topics such as sensory needs, dementia considerations and other important topics to improve guests' experiences.
Community engagement, working independently, project management and public speaking are some of the skills this PHENND Fellow will learn and strengthen.
